Kathmandu: Nepal has won the title of the ACC U-16 East Zone Cup cricket tournament, remaining undefeated. In the final held on Saturday, Nepal clinched the title by defeating Singapore by 2 wickets.
Chasing a modest target of 114 runs set by Singapore, Nepal completed the chase in 29 overs, losing 8 wickets. Joy Thapa played an unbeaten knock of 24 runs for Nepal.

Earlier, after winning the toss and opting to bat first, Singapore was bowled out for 113 runs in 40.5 overs. Rohan Austin top-scored for Singapore with 23 runs, facing over 90 balls. Rihan Naik contributed 15 runs.
For Nepal, Abhay Yadav took 3 wickets for 34 runs in 10 overs. Sushil Bahadur Rawal also claimed 3 wickets, while Shubham Khanal took 2 wickets, and captain Bipin Prasad Sharma picked up 1 wicket.
Nepal won the title undefeated in the tournament, having previously beaten Singapore in the group stage as well.
